A Ross County man is being held in the Ross County Jail after being arrested on an indictment charging him with Gross Sexual Imposition, a third-degree felony.
According to jail records, Corey T. Grubb, 34, of Chillicothe, was arrested on July 18 on a warrant issued following a Ross County Grand Jury indictment. He was booked into the Ross County Jail later that evening and is currently being held without bond.
Ross County Common Pleas Court records show the indictment was filed on January 16, 2026, charging Grubb with one count of Gross Sexual Imposition (R.C. 2907.05), a felony of the third degree. Court records further indicate a warrant was issued the same day and was returned as served on July 20 after Grubb’s arrest.
Grubb appeared for arraignment Monday before Judge Michael M. Ater. A criminal pretrial hearing has been scheduled for August 17, 2026.
As with all criminal cases, the charge is an allegation, and Grubb is presumed innocent unless and until proven guilty in a court of law.
